
The average Appian UX Researcher in Boulder earns an estimated $103,822 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$94,069 with a $9,753 bonus. Appian's UX Researcher compensation is $7,425 more than the US average for a UX Researcher. UX Researcher salaries at Appian in Boulder can range from $50,000 - $200,000.
In Boulder, The Design Department at Appian earns $1,904 more on average than the Marketing Department.

In Boulder, UX Researchers earn $5,028 more than UI/UX Designers, and $9,763 less than Senior UI/UX Designers.
In Boulder, The Design Department averages $1,904 more than the Marketing Department, and $2,669 less than the Engineering Department
The average female UX Researcher at companies similar size to Appian reported making $102,788, while the average male U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$101,646.
The average Hispanic or Latino UX Researcher at companies similar size to Appian reported making $109,625, while the average Caucasian U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$94,559.
